Island Tours

If you are visiting Sylt for the first time, a great way to get an overview of the island is to take part in a bus tour. The Sylt Transport Association hast wo tours on offer that accommodate different interests and timetables. The small island tour takes about two hours and travels from Wenningstedt and Kampen to List. Here you have a bit of time to enjoy the gorgeous dune landscapes of Germany’s most northern township and also visit the “Ellenbogen”, or “Elbow” of Sylt – the most northern point of the island. After a short break the island tour continues to the villages of Braderup, Munkmarsch, Keitum and Tinnum. The final destination of the tour is Westerland Station.

Plan a little more time for the long island tour. In three to three-and-a-half hours, participants will also journey to the island’s most southernly point. This journey will take you from Rantum to Hörnum, the most southern township in Sylt. Here you will also have the opportunity to visit the Hörnum Odde, a protected dune and heather landscape. Both island tours are great for getting a first overview of Sylt and receiving fascinating information about the island.
